
Senior Government Officail Missing
DHUBRI: Efforts are on to trace a senior government official who went missing after his boat capsized in the Brahmaputra river in Assam’s Dhubri district.
A mechanized boat carrying 29 passengers capsized in the Brahmaputra river in Assam’s Dhubri district near the Bangladesh border on Thursday.
24 hours later, search and rescue personnel from the Assam State Disaster Response Force (SDRF) and the Border Security Force (BSF) are trying to locate the missing government official, who is still missing.
However, the other 28 passengers were rescued by the Assam SDRF and BSF search and rescue personnel.
The missing Assam government official has been identified as Sanju Das, a circle officer in Assam’s Dhubri district.
The boat overturned near the Dhubri-Phulbari bridge on the Brahmaputra river in Assam near the Bangladesh border when it reportedly hit something.
